Quotes about Shattered Trust
“Betrayal can only happen if you love.”
John le Carré
In this quote, John le Carré explores the connection between love and betrayal. He suggests that betrayal can only happen when there is love, highlighting the vulnerability that comes with deep connections.
This thought-provoking statement reminds us of the delicate balance between trust and betrayal, emphasizing how love can leave us susceptible to heartbreak.
In a world where love and betrayal coexist, le Carre’s words remind us of the impact of our relationships and the choices we make within them.

“The liar’s punishment is not in the least that he is not believed, but that he cannot believe anyone else.”
George Bernard Shaw
George Bernard Shaw delves into the profound consequences of dishonesty. He astutely points out that while liars may face the skepticism of others, the true punishment lies in the erosion of trust they experience themselves.
As they construct their lives on a foundation of falsehoods, it becomes increasingly challenging for them to expect authenticity from those around them.
Thus the true toll of betrayal is isolation and loneliness.

“Betrayal is the worst… and the key to moving past it is to identify what led up to it in the first place.
Charles J. Orlando
Charles Orlando wisely suggests that in order to heal and move forward, it is essential to not only acknowledge the betrayal itself but also to delve deeper into the circumstances that led up to it.
By taking the time to identify the factors, whether they be miscommunication, unmet expectations, or other underlying issues, we can gain a clearer understanding of what went wrong and why.
This introspection allows us to learn valuable lessons from the past and empowers us to build stronger and more authentic relationships in the future.
It is through this process of self-reflection and growth that we can truly find healing and move towards a brighter and more fulfilling future.

“You don’t repair that relationship by sitting down and talking about trust or making promises. Actually, what rebuilds it is living it and doing things differently.“
Patricia Hewitt
Patricia Hewitt emphasizes that repairing a relationship is not solely achieved through discussions or promises of trust.
True rebuilding comes from actively living the values of trust and taking actions that demonstrate a change in behavior.
She is thus reminding us that actions speak louder than words when it comes to rebuilding and strengthening relationships.
Regaining trust is about consistently showing up, being reliable, and following through on our commitments.
By doing things differently, we break free from old patterns that may have caused harm or led to a breakdown in trust.
It’s a conscious effort to make choices that align with building a stronger foundation for the relationship.
